Git如何获得两个版本间所有变更的文件列表
高洛峰
高洛峰 2017-04-21 11:17:00
0
4
744

如题,要获得两个版本间所有(增加/修改/删除)的文件列表,应该使用什么命令呢?

高洛峰
高洛峰

拥有18年软件开发和IT教学经验。曾任多家上市公司技术总监、架构师、项目经理、高级软件工程师等职务。 网络人气名人讲师,...

membalas semua(4)
Peter_Zhu
git diff --name-status HEAD~2 HEAD~3

Untuk butiran, sila rujuk dokumentasi

刘奇

git diff hash1 hash1 --stat

Jika ia cawangan

git diff branch1 branch2 --stat

Tambah --stat untuk memaparkan senarai fail, jika tidak, ia akan menjadi perbezaan kandungan fail

洪涛
git diff <commit> <commit>

<komit> di atas mewakili rentetan cincang yang dijana dengan menyerahkan,
Contohnya:

git diff b45ba47d1b297217e3ec6a3ab0f61716a8d6ecbc c244d0bf06d56ec86aaedeefa5dcd84dd9febc60

Secara umumnya, pembezaan boleh dibuat dengan 4 hingga 6 digit pertama rentetan cincang, yang boleh disingkatkan sebagai:

git diff b45b 355e
小葫芦

git diff commit-SHA1 commit-SHA2 --stat

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an